Kathryn Loder

Kathryn Loder

Actor

Fecha de nacimiento: 23 de junio de 1940. Lugar de nacimiento: Laramie, Wyoming, USA

Kathryn (Kay) Loder, grew up in Nebraska and Texas, the daughter of a drama professor and an elementary school principal. Her mother was Frances Loder, who taught theater at the University of Texas at Austin for many years. Her older brother was James Edwin Loder, a renowned theologian who taught at Princeton Theological Seminary. Loder discussed his younger sister in his book, "The Transforming Moment," saying that a religious experience at the age of 14 diverted her from an emotionally troubled childhood towards a career in the theater. Her distinctive voice and looks, as well as her operatic acting style, made her perfectly suited to play memorable female villains in exploitation pics such as "The Big Doll House" and "Foxy Brown." It is no small irony that the genre itself was passing around the time of her death in 1978.
